I have no idea what that is. Or where it would be located...

All I know is every time I hit new game, or try to load an old saved game I get an error message saying that the AAFE.aki file has failed to load. And then it shuts my Final Fantasy VII game down, dropping me back to desktop. O.O

I am pretty sure it has something to do with the char, or flevel.lgps, because I can start the game okay. And I am fairly certain it has to do with all of my personal mods, they most likely have the LGPs all clogged up. Hehe... I am content in not using my personal mods, cause I know a clean install runs just fine; but if it is at all possible, I would like to know if there is a simple solution to this, like opening the original Char.lgp or flevel.lgp and copy and pasting the missing file to my new lgp file..or?

I am using Aali's custom graphics drivers, and The Team Avalanche Overhaul mod, as well as the APZ custom Cloud battle model, and Ficedula's Music mod. On top of it all I have many personal mods installed...

I know I have the 1.02 patch installed, and the drivers ARE working, I have checked several times, the app log should be evidence enough. ;).

aafe is an animation

replace it with the original
